How much does it cost to rent an apartment in South Los Angeles?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
South Los Angeles Studio Apartments | $1,859 | $900 | $6,678 |
South Los Angeles 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,206 | $832 | $5,880 |
South Los Angeles 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,667 | $1,750 | $6,253 |
South Los Angeles 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,139 | $2,047 | $7,000 |
South Los Angeles 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,928 | $2,684 | $3,550 |
South Los Angeles 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,800 | $3,800 | $3,800 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gated South Los Angeles Apartments
What is the Cheapest Gated apartment in South Los Angeles?
Currently the most affordable Gated Apartment in South Los Angeles is at ML Shepard Manor (55+ Community) listed at $832.
How much is the average rent for a Gated South Los Angeles Apartment?
The average rent for a Gated Apartment in South Los Angeles is $2,345.
What is the largest Gated South Los Angeles Apartment for rent?
Today's Gated apartment with the most square footage in South Los Angeles is a 1,500 square feet unit starting from $1,595 at Windmill Creek Apartments.
What is the average size for South Los Angeles Gated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Gated rental in South Los Angeles is currently at 694 sq ft.
